Abstract

See full text

A method is disclosed for seeking from first radial position on a spiral track of a magnetic disk drive to a second radial position. The disk having the spiral track rotates at a constant angular velocity. The servo sectors on the spiral track may not be aligned along a radius. A head transit time is determined for moving the head to the second radial position. A first control current pulse is applied to an actuator to move the head toward the second radial position. A timer is commenced for measuring the expiration of the head transit time after applying the first control current pulse. After expiration of the head transit time, a second control current pulse is applied to the actuator to terminate the head movement. At least one servo sector along the spiral track is then read to locate the position of the head.
